Choose a tab to display the related commands. Select Show Tabs and Ribbon to display ribbon tabs and commands at all times. To collapse the Ribbon to see more of a document, double-click any ribbon tab or press CTRL + F1. To expand the Ribbon, double-click any ribbon tab or press CTRL + F1. Add Rows and Columns Using the Context Menu. Another quick way to add rows and columns involves revealing the context menu in Microsoft Word tables. On the File tab, click the Options button: 2. In the Word Options dialog box, select the Customize Ribbon tab: 3. To create a new tab, select the tab, after which you want to insert the new tab and then click the New Tab button: To rename a tab, select it and click the Rename button or right-click in it and choose Rename in the popup menu: 4.

Step 1: Find Word Options. Step 2: Select Customize Ribbon. Step 3: Add the Developer Tab to Main Tabs. Step 4: Find the Developer Tab. The illustration above depicts a Word document that does not have the developer tab enabled. To be able to use the Word developer tools, this tab needs to be manually activated.
